A leading estate agency in Bournemouth is seeking a Senior Sales Negotiator to handle daily property sales operations. The role involves exceptional customer service to maximize revenue, building client relationships, arranging viewings, and supporting clients in their buying and selling journeys.

Ideal candidates will have a proven background in estate agency and lettings, strong communication skills, and proficiency in property management systems. A full UK driving license and access to a vehicle is preferred.

How to prepare for a job interview at Countrywide Estate Agents

Know Your Property Market

Before the interview, brush up on the local property market in Bournemouth. Understand current trends, average prices, and what makes properties sell. This knowledge will show your potential employer that you're not just interested in the role but also invested in the area.

Showcase Your Customer Service Skills

Prepare examples of how you've provided exceptional customer service in previous roles. Think about specific situations where you went above and beyond for a client. This will demonstrate your ability to build strong client relationships, which is crucial for a Senior Sales Negotiator.

Familiarise Yourself with Property Management Systems

Since proficiency in property management systems is key for this role, make sure you’re familiar with the software commonly used in the industry. If you’ve used any specific systems before, be ready to discuss your experience and how it can benefit the agency.

Prepare Questions to Ask

Interviews are a two-way street, so prepare thoughtful questions to ask your interviewer. Inquire about the agency's approach to client relationships or how they support their negotiators in achieving sales targets.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
